Homestay | Barcelona (08003)
Homestay | Barcelona (08002)
Homestay | Barcelona (08002)
Homestay | Barcelona (08002)
Homestay | Barcelona (08002)
Homestay | Barcelona (08002)
Homestay | Barcelona (08002)
Shared accommodation | Barcelona
Shared accommodation | Barcelona
Homestay | Barcelona (08024)
Homestay | Barcelona (08013)
Homestay | Barcelona (08023)
Homestay | Barcelona (08003)
Shared accommodation | Barcelona (08003)
Homestay | Barcelona (08012)
Homestay | Barcelona (08012)
Homestay | Barcelona (08023) | 99 M2
Homestay | Barcelona (08003)